MR WINSTON CHURCHILL
SHOWN MOST SECRET PARTS OF MAGINOT LINE.
By Telegraph—Press Association—Copyright. (Received This Dav. 10.0 a.m.) STRASBURG, August 15. Mr Winston Churchill was shown the most secret parts of the Maginot Line, but journalists were not allowed to accompany the party.
